The user-defined function gcd calculates the greatest common divisor of the two numbers. The iteration starts with the value i=1. The gcd must be less than or equal to both numbers, so the condition of for loop is, i<=a && i<=b.

The Greatest Common Divisor (GCD) of two numbers is the largest number that divides both of them. For example: Let’s say we have two numbers are 45 and 27. 45 = 5 * 3 * 3 27 = 3 * 3 * 3. You want the greatest common divisor, but your for loop starts with the smallest possible divisor. Turn it around and go in the other direction. Also note that you know that the greatest common divisor is going to be at most the smaller of the two numbers. fmcsa short haul definitionWebIf the GCD = 1, the numbers are said to be relatively prime.
